Why is October National Pizza Month?

NATIONAL PIZZA MONTH HISTORY

National Pizza Month began in October 1984 and was created by the publisher of Pizza Today magazine and pizzeria owner, Gerry Durnell. He chose October because it’s the month the first issue of his magazine debuted..

Where is the annual Pizza Expo held?

Held in the Las Vegas Convention Center, this annual conference is the world’s largest pizza trade show with over 1,400 booths and 550 exhibitors. Pizza Expo is a yearly event where pizza makers from all over the world gather to display, compete, and learn about the latest pizza trends.

When was pizza invented month?

An often recounted story holds that on June 11, 1889, to honour the queen consort of Italy, Margherita of Savoy, the Neapolitan pizza maker Raffaele Esposito created the “Pizza Margherita”, a pizza garnished with tomatoes, mozzarella, and basil, to represent the national colours of Italy as on the Flag of Italy.

Who invented pizza?

Specifically, baker Raffaele Esposito from Naples is often given credit for making the first such pizza pie. Historians note, however, that street vendors in Naples sold flatbreads with toppings for many years before then. Legend has it that Italian King Umberto I and Queen Margherita visited Naples in 1889.

Is the pizza Expo in Las Vegas open to the public?

Pizza Expo is a B2B trade show and is not open to the general public.

Who won pizza Expo?

Antonio’s Italian Ristorante took the honors. The International Pizza Expo is the largest pizza-making competition in the United States. Antonio’s has now brought home a winning pizza in competitions over the past three years.

How many people attend the International Pizza Expo? Well over 8,000 buyers converged on the Las Vegas Convention Center to see, shop, sample and buy at the International Pizza Expo 2019. We set records for attendees, exhibitors and net square footage of exhibit space.
